I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Forms Oracle Discussion :

MAITRE/DETAIL ET LOV


Sujet :

Forms Oracle

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Avril 2003
    Messages
    114
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2003
    Messages : 114
    Par défaut MAITRE/DETAIL ET LOV
    Bonjour,

    Voila j'ai un bloc maître : PERSONNE
    un bloc détail : ADRESSE
    J'ai donc fait une relation entre les 2 sur l' ID_ADRESSE
    Et j'ai une LOV qui me récupère le nom de la personne au niveau du bloc maître.

    Lorsque je sélectionne le nom via ma LOV les infos s'affichent bien au niveau du bloc maître par contre rien pour le détail.

    De plus, ensuite, lorsque je clique dans l'item ADRESSE.ID_ADRESSE je récupère bien le même ID que PERSONNE.ID_ADRESSE et que je clique sur le bouton "Exécuter l'interrogation" de la barre de menu par defaut de FORMS, il me récupère les infos de mon bloc détail.

    Alors qqn aurait une idée pour résoudre mon pb?

    Merci par avance
    couse1

  2. #2
    Invité de passage
    Inscrit en
    Mai 2010
    Messages
    1
    Détails du profil
    Informations forums :
    Inscription : Mai 2010
    Messages : 1
    Par défaut Inès
    normalement vous devez mettre dans le déclencheur du module
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    when_validate_item 
    go_block ('PERSONNE');
    execute_query;
    last_record;
    go_block('ADRESSE');
    execute_query;
    last_record;
    autre chose avec le bouton LOV c'est énervant on ne peut plus modifier et enregistrer normalement avec commit, il faut tout le temps exécuter et enregistrer les changement.....
    je ne suis pas encore arrivée à trouver une solution si vous la trouverez s'il vous plaît donnez moi la solution.

  3. #3
    Membre expérimenté Avatar de mongilotti
    Profil pro
    Inscrit en
    Février 2003
    Messages
    314
    Détails du profil
    Informations personnelles :
    Localisation : Tunisie

    Informations forums :
    Inscription : Février 2003
    Messages : 314
    Par défaut
    c'est normale ce qui ce passe car, il y'a pas un execute_query sur le block détail.
    si tu test en entrant une interrogation tu aura bien les infos dans les blocs maitre et détail.

  4. #4
    Membre confirmé
    Profil pro
    Inscrit en
    Octobre 2006
    Messages
    67
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2006
    Messages : 67
    Par défaut
    Citation Envoyé par couse1 Voir le message
    Voila j'ai un bloc maître : PERSONNE
    un bloc détail : ADRESSE
    un bloc maître : PERSONNE
    un bloc détail : ADRESSE
    ==> la clé primaire de PERSONNE est une clé étrangère dans ADRESSE

    personne (id_pers,nom,...)
    adresse (id_adr,id_pers,...)

    Vérifiez bien les relations.

    Si vous faites LOV pour le bloc maitre :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    declare var boolean;
    begin
       var:=show_lov('lov_lst_pers');
       execute_query;
    end;

Discussions similaires

  1. Insertion dans 2 tables (Maitre + detaille )
    Par nil dans le forum Bases de données
    Réponses: 11
    Dernier message: 09/11/2005, 21h30
  2. [TTable] Pb avec une relation maitre-detail
    Par kase74 dans le forum Bases de données
    Réponses: 3
    Dernier message: 24/10/2005, 10h34
  3. [jdbc/JAVA] maitre/detail ;qlq a un lien!
    Par b_52globemaster dans le forum JDBC
    Réponses: 8
    Dernier message: 03/08/2005, 20h44
  4. [C#] [WinForms] DataGrids maitre / details séparés
    Par aeled dans le forum Windows Forms
    Réponses: 4
    Dernier message: 08/03/2005, 12h18
  5. [Ferme] DBLookup fiche detail (relation maitre detail)
    Par boyerf dans le forum Bases de données
    Réponses: 3
    Dernier message: 26/02/2004, 20h12

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o